In 1968, Christopher Nupen founded one of the first (if not the first) independent television production companies in the United Kingdom. Aided by the invention of silent 16mm film cameras, Nupen became the pioneer of a completely new and intimate style, blending documentary and performance on film. He instinctively filmed musicians at close quarters on stage (and backstage), in their natural environment, where they have most to offer. The effects were dramatic and brought countless numbers of people to music for the first time, breaking down the barriers between musicians and the wider public. Over 70 productions, spanning five decades, the Allegro Films music archive is a unique body of work that remembers many of our great artists, as no other medium can equal.
Today, Allegro Films is as busy as ever, under the stewardship of Christopher Nupen’s wife Caroline and the film-maker Matthew Percival.

In 1970, Argentinian-Israeli conductor and pianist Daniel Barenboim and his close friend, filmmaker Christopher Nupen, collaborated on a thirteen-part series about Ludwig van Beethoven - marking the occasion of the 200th anniversary of the composer's birth. Lost to the British public for half a century, this series of films has never been shown together on national television in the UK. Now, as...
